Sri Lanka foreign reserves rise to $6.8bn in December

Summary by EconomyNext
ECONOMYNEXT – Sri Lanka’s foreign reserves rose to 6.8 billion US dollars in December 2025, up 791 million dollars from November, official data show. November data was revised up slightly to 6,034 million dollars. In December Sri Lanka got budget support loans from the Asian Development Bank and the International Monetary Fund.
